Read More »Dollywood’s Owner Expands Its Reach with Acquisition of Silverwood Theme Park
Major Acquisition Announcement Herschend, the owner of Dollywood, has officially acquired Silverwood Theme Park and Boulder Beach Water Park, situated in Athol, Idaho. This significant move marks Silverwood as the largest theme park in the Northwest, enhancing Herschend’s presence in the region. The acquisition aligns well with the company’s vision to extend its reach across the United States while honoring ...
